Well, my dream build changes pretty much every time a new part comes out, so it's a tough question to answer. As we speak, though, the parts for my new rig are being shipped to me, and while it might not have all the bells and whistles I could have picked up—I'd rather pocket the extra cash—I got everything I really wanted. This is the build I went with. There's no CPU cooler listed on there because that site, for some reason, didn't have a record of the one I bought. Also, I'm keeping my old peripherals: Razer Taipan mouse, Razer BlackWidow Ultimate keyboard, Plantronics Gamecom 788 headset, and a 23" LG monitor.

For the moment, this build should have plenty of power to max out the settings on almost any game that will release this year, and I'm going to overclock the hell out of it. If I want a bit more performance, I'll consider adding another 970 later in the year.
